Common Questions and Answers
What Qualifications Should I Consider When Choosing a General Contractor?
When choosing a general contractor, it is important to consider essential criteria such as valid licensing, comprehensive insurance coverage, a strong portfolio of previous work, reliable references, and strong communication abilities to guarantee a successful renovation project.
How Can I Effectively Communicate My Vision to the Contractor
To clearly communicate ideas to a contractor, one should use precise visuals, comprehensive descriptions, and honest communication. Regular updates and feedback sessions enhance understanding, ensuring both parties align on project goals and expectations across the full renovation process.
What Key Elements Should I Include in My Contract With a General Contractor?
The agreement with a general contractor ought to cover project scope, payment schedules, timelines, materials specifications, warranties, and conflict resolution procedures. Clearly communicating expectations promotes alignment and helps prevent misunderstandings throughout the remodeling process.
How Can I Verify a Contractor's References and Past Work?
To confirm a contractor's previous work and references, one should get in touch with past clients, obtain photos of completed projects, and look up online ratings. Furthermore, viewing completed work can offer direct insight into the contractor's workmanship and dependability.
